Title:

Horsham, East Parade Baptist Church - Registration for solemnizing marriages.

Date:

4 Jul 1899.

Body:

NOTICE is hereby given, that a separate building named Baptist Church, situated at East Parade, in the civil parish of, Horsham, in the county of Sussex, in the registration district of Horsham, being, a building certified according to law as a place of meeting for religious worship, was on the 26th day of June, 1899, duly registered for solemnizing marriages therein, pursuant to the Act of 6th and 7th Wm. 4, c. 85. — Witness my hand this 26th day of June, 1899.

A. C. COOTE, Superintendent Registrar.
